Priya's family exchanged 250 dollars for 4,250 pesos. Priya bought a sweater for 510 pesos. How many dollars did the sweater cos
t? Pesos dollars 4,250 250 25 1 3 510
1 answer:
Answer:
$30
Step-by-step explanation:
since they exchanged them we can assume they are worth the same
250=4250
First find how many pesos is worth 1 dollar
4250/250= 17
Then divide the amount the sweater costs by how much 1 dollar would be
510/17= 30
The sweater would cost 30 dollars.
